Feather River College is a public, two-year community college fully accredited by the Western Association of Schools and Colleges. The campus sits perched on a forested mountainside, tucked away in one of California's hidden, quiet spots. Bordering Plumas National Forest, the campus is more than 400 acres and hosts various wildlife, including a deer herd.
